The city of Brussels under German occupation during World War II.

Belgians living under German occupation in Brussels during World War II. Women and men ride bicycles in the streets of Brussels, Belgium. People walking in a crowded street, likely near the Great Place or Bourse de Bruxelles. A woman in an elaborate hat walks past people in the street. Trams move along the city roads. Civilians and military personnel dining at a street café. A view of the ‘Maison du Roi’ or King's House and the Guildhalls at the Grand Place (Grote Markt, 1000 Brussel, Belgium), the central square of Brussels. View of the Great Place and its square. Soldiers look at birds in cages. Vendors selling various foods and vegetables. A woman vendor slicing cheese. German Luftwaffe airmen taste the cheese as civilians look on.

U.S. Army Lieutenant General Patton comes onto a shore in a landing craft in Sicily, Italy during World War II.

Allied invasion of Sicily, Italy during World War II. U.S. Army Lieutenant General George S. Patton, Commander of the U.S. Seventh Army, along with a soldier aboard a troop ship. Soldiers mark a sheet. Lt. Gen. Patton with a cigar in his mouth as he goes over the side of the ship. He climbs down a rope net into a landing craft. Lt. Gen. Patton seated aboard the landing craft, accompanied by several armed soldiers and officers, including a Brigadier General, as it approaches a beach in the Gulf of Gela, South-Central Sicily. A captain and soldier help Lt. General Patton to get off the landing craft. Patton and officers, including the Brigadier General who accompanied him on the landing craft, stand together on the beach. Patton and the Brigadier General both wear 1st Armored Division patches on their uniforms. General Patton stands watching as army vehicles including trucks,halftracks,jeeps, and heavy armor, offload from Landing ships. Officers and soldiers on the beach take temporary cover as explosions occur close offshore, from enemy artillery fire.

High School students contribute to improvements in housing conditions in New York City

Two High School boys stand on a New York city street. Tenament buildings are behind them. children play on the sidewalks and in the street including one riding a home-made roller skate box scooter with the number 2 on it. The boys walk past many children. They are making not of buildings with inadequate fire escapes. Scene suddenly shifts to a boy standing on a bridge overlooking railroad tracks. He is annotating a map or buildings along Lexington Avenue in Manhattan. Next, the student is seen presenting information about this matter and engaging in a discussion about it with classmates. Later, a student spokesman is seen presenting findings about housing inadaquacies to an assembly of people. Local people demonstrate in the streets, carrying banners decrying current conditions. Scene shifts to new housing projects with playgrounds and seemingly better conditions for the residents. Children are seen running in Central Park. A woman (teacher) with children on a ferry boat looking at the skyline of lower Manhattan. (World War II period).
